On the flip side of that, Jalen hurts went through two playoff games while throwing maybe 3 passes to the MOF.

Kellen designed plays that attacked the sideline over and over and over again and they succeeded. If you chart the NFC championship games 0 of Hurts targets were thrown past 10 yards MOF.

Why? Because he’s not comfy doing it. Yet under Moore it didn’t hurt him in the least bit. That’s why I said imagine what Moore can do w/ a QB who can hit all levels of the field
I can attribute some of what the Eagles did to the fact that they had such a great running game with Barkley. Opposing defenses were really concentrating on stopping the run and in turn there were a lot more 2nd level defenders concentrated in the middle of the field. For much of the season Hurts wasn't throwing much and in the playoffs, averaging low 20s in pass attempts and taking advantage of his own run game.

Moore won't have that option here immediately because of our O line play that saw the pocket collapsing from the middle and not getting nearly as many rushing yards up the middle as Philly was getting. Which was forcing the QB to roll out and find his targets and more rushes around the edge.
